> > Hi All,
> >
> > FYI I am going through the github issues and doing some organization. I
> > am closing stale issues that look like they did not end up moving
> > forward; if you're on one of those tickets and feel the ticket still
> > needs to be addressed, feel free to reopen or file an updated ticket.
> >
> > For other tickets, I am sorting them into the following milestones:
> >
> > 6.x - issues that should target the csound6 branch. These really should
> > only be bugfixes at this point.
> >
> > 7.0.0 - Issues that should be in the initial CS7 release.
> >
> > 7.x - Issues that should be done in the CS7 release train but are not
> > necessary for the initial 7.0.0 release. We can discuss regularly to see
> > if there are stories to move between 7.0.0 and 7.x.
> >
> > Issues that are not in a milestone require further vetting and
> scheduling.
> >
